    Not a bad set, but I think it would have been better with "Bload Oath". In my opinion, that was the best Deep Space Nine episode focused on Klingons. It was cool to see the three from the original series reunited, but weird how differently some of them acted from how they originally were. Kor, who was so ruthless and vicious in "Errand of Mercy" was just a silly drunk. In "The Trouble with Tribbles", I just thought Koloth was way too nice to be a Klingon, what with his being so cordial and bowing a lot. Maybe it's because William Campbell is just a really nice guy. Even as Trelane I thought he came across as just too nice and cheerful to be an intimidating villain. In "Blood Oath", he acted so much more like a "traditional" Klingon that he seemed like a completely different person. The make-up helped achieve that effect too. If I didn't know better, I'd think it was a different actor in the role.
